Prince Baran is a Marvel Comics character.

[edit] Fictional character biography

He was the Prince and absolute ruler of Madripoor. His personal home is extravegent, including rarities such as a tentacled monster in the garden pond. While not actually a supervillain, he was sometimes on the "bad side". He is seen on "Wolverine" #6 and #7, confronting the trio of Logan, Karma and Archie Corrigan. Nguyen Ngoc Coy, Karma's uncle and Baran's man, is involved in the fight. Baran also allows the villans Roughhouse and Bloodscream to work for him.

Later Baran makes a deal with the villan Geist.[1]

At one time, he employs the private eye Jessica Drew as a spy. She is told to keep an eye on several people, including Patch. Eventually, when Wolverine finds out that the Prince had made a deal with Geist, he humiliates him in front of many of his subjects.

Baran and Coy later conspire to have Wolverine framed for murder. They have Archie Corrigan and several of his friends murdered with what seems like Logan's claws. Coy and Baran are slain soon after.
